Thanks, guys. A new important detail: seems that those bars don’t move when the frequency changes, so that would seem to rule out external causes. Listening (with real ears!) on SSB, I don’t detect anything unusual. I could live with the visual distortion I see for signals within the offending “bars,” but I see NO signals between about 1450 and 1650 FT8 offsets – on any band, as you can see below on a packed 15M band. The bars themselves run from about 900-1300, and 1800-2200. All WSJT modes show the same thing. I’ve rebooted everything, BTW, and no change.
